Now the largest … proton beam therapy for lung cancerWebThe Grignon Mansion is a proud reminder of our state's beginnings. Restored to the time period of 1837-62, when Charles lived there, the Mansion is a beautiful link to our heritage. Costumed guides lead group tours (10 or more people) of the Mansion.
